What if changing your life was as simple as changing your environment? On this episode of the Rowing Industry Podcast, we promise to unlock the secrets of habit formation through psychological insights. We kick off with an enthusiastic discussion emphasizing the role of psychology in fitness and health. Drawing from James Clear's "Atomic Habits," we delve into the power of tiny, consistent changes. Discover how making your habits obvious, attractive, easy, and satisfying can revolutionize your approach to fitness and beyond.
Ever wondered why some people seem effortlessly disciplined? It's not superhuman willpower—it's smart environmental design! We break down how crafting your surroundings can set you up for success. From keeping your workout gear visible to pairing enjoyable activities with new habits, we provide practical tips to make your fitness goals more attainable. Learn why community support is essential and how starting with manageable steps can ensure your new routines stick.
Struggling to maintain a fitness routine amidst a hectic schedule? We simplify workout strategies with exercises that require minimal equipment, perfect for home or on-the-go fitness. For professionals like those in law enforcement or the military, meal planning becomes a game-changer. Additionally, we explore the significance of rewarding yourself in non-food ways and why tracking your progress through various metrics is crucial. Finally, we journey through the lens of the hero's journey, highlighting how overcoming struggles can lead to profound personal growth and a clear path toward achieving your goals.
